Walt Whitman: A Pioneer of American Poetry and Individuality

Walt Whitman (1819-1892) is a pivotal figure in American poetry, best known for his innovative style and themes that celebrate individuality and the human experience.

Wò ěr tè · Huì tè màn (1819-1892) shì Měiguó shīgē zhōng de yīgè guānjiàn rénwù, yǐ qí chuàngxīn de fēnggé hé qìngzhù gèxìng jí rénlèi jīnglì de zhǔtí ér wénmíng.

沃尔特·惠特曼(1819-1892)是美国诗歌中的一个关键人物,以其创新的风格和庆祝个性及人类经历的主题而闻名。

His seminal work, 'Leaves of Grass,' revolutionized the form of poetry by embracing free verse and incorporating a wide range of subjects, from personal introspection to the celebration of the American landscape and democracy.

Tā de zhòngyào zuòpǐn《Cǎoyè jí》tōngguò yōngbào zìyóushī hé hánɡài ɡuǎnɡfàn zhǔtí, chèdǐ ɡǎibiànle shīgē de xíngshì, cóng gèrén nèixǐnɡ dào qìngzhù Měiguó de zìrán jǐnɡuān hé mínzhǔ.

他的重要作品《草叶集》通过拥抱自由诗和涵盖广泛主题,彻底改变了诗歌的形式,从个人内省到庆祝美国的自然景观和民主。

Whitman's poetry often reflects his belief in the interconnectedness of all people and his deep reverence for nature.

Huì tè màn de shī ɡē chánɡchán fǎnyìnle tā duì suǒyǒu rén xiānghù liánxì de xìnniàn hé tā duì zìrán de shēnqiè zūnzhònɡ.

惠特曼的诗歌常常反映了他对所有人相互联系的信念和他对自然的深切尊重。

Throughout his life, Whitman worked as a teacher, journalist, and nurse, experiences that shaped his views and writings.

Zài tā de yīshēnɡ zhōnɡ, Huì tè màn céng dān rèn jiàoshī, jìzhě hé hùshì, zhèxiē jīnglì sùzàole tā de ɡuān diǎn hé zuòpǐn.

在他的一生中,惠特曼曾担任教师、记者和护士,这些经历塑造了他的观点和作品。

His poetry contains a distinct voice that embodies the spirit of America, reflecting the country's diversity and complexities.

Tā de shī ɡē bāohán yī zhǒnɡ dútè de shēnɡyīn, tǐxiànle Měiɡuó de jīnɡshén, fǎnyìnle ɡuójiā de duōyànɡxìnɡ hé fùzáxìnɡ.

他的诗歌包含一种独特的声音,体现了美国的精神,反映了国家的多样性和复杂性。

He celebrated the physical body, labor, and the common man, often advocating for social and political reform, which resonated during a time of national turmoil, including the Civil War.

Tā zànměile shēntǐ, láodòng hé pǔtōng rén, chánɡchán chànɡdǎo shèhuì hé zhèngzhì ɡǎiɡé, zhè zài ɡuójiā dòngdànɡ de shíqī yǐnqǐ ɡònɡmínɡ, bāokuò nèizhàn.

他赞美了身体、劳动和普通人,常常倡导社会和政治改革,这在国家动荡的时期引起共鸣,包括内战。

Whitman's legacy endures as he continues to influence poets and writers around the world.

Huì tè màn de yíchǎn chíxù cúnzài, yīnwèi tā jìxù yǐnɡxiǎnɡzhe shìjiè ɡèdì de shīrén hé zuòjiā.

惠特曼的遗产持续存在,因为他继续影响着世界各地的诗人和作家。

His works remain a fundamental part of American literature, and he is revered for his contributions to the development of modern poetry.

Tā de zuòpǐn rénɡrán shì Měiɡuó wénxué de yīgè jīběn bùfèn, tā yīn duì xiàndài shīgē fāzhǎn de ɡòngxiàn ér shòudào zūnjìnɡ.

他的作品仍然是美国文学的一个基本部分,他因对现代诗歌发展的贡献而受到尊敬。

His fearless exploration of self and society invites readers to engage with their own identities and the world around them.

Tā duì zìwǒ hé shèhuì wúwèi de tànsuǒ yāoqǐnɡ dúzhě yǔ tāmen zìjǐ de shēnfèn yǐjí zhōuwéi de shìjiè hùdònɡ.

他对自我和社会无畏的探索邀请读者与他们自己的身份以及周围的世界互动。
